Well here is the answer to your questions!If you enjoyed this video, be sure to like, comment & subscri...This breaks down just a tad further to being divided into hostile mobs and passive mobs. These are not tied together. By default, hostile mob cap is 75. You could have 75 sheep in the area and still have 75 hostile mobs spawn around you. You could nametag 74 zombies and throw them in a pit and make it so only 1 hostile mob is eligible to spawn.Start by digging a 2 x 2 ditch for the piston clock, then place a redstone torch in each of the spaces. 2. This is how it is intended to work; mobs do not spawn within a 24 block radius from you, so you need to go over 24 blocks away from your farm. You should not go further than 128 blocks away from it however, as mobs despawn immediately outside of that radius. Share. The mob spawning mechanics aren't the same in Bedrock Edition compared to Java Edition. In Bedrock, the cap on the number of mobs is lower which basically means that there can't be as many mobs in your world.
